How the Sensor System Creates the Closing Condition in Bryn Athyn

The safety sensor system consists of a transmitter and a receiver mounted at the bottom of the door opening on each side in Bryn Athyn, PA. The transmitter sends a continuous infrared beam to the receiver in Bryn Athyn. When the receiver detects the full beam, it sends a continuous confirmation signal to the opener's logic board indicating a clear path in Bryn Athyn, PA. The logic board will complete the closing cycle only while this confirmation signal is continuously present in Bryn Athyn. Any interruption of the signal causes the logic board to reverse the door immediately in Bryn Athyn, PA.

The Four LED States and What Each One Means in Bryn Athyn, PA

There are four possible LED states across the two sensors that EZ Open reads on arrival in Bryn Athyn. Both LEDs solid indicates correct sensor alignment and function in Bryn Athyn, PA. Receiver LED blinking, transmitter LED solid indicates sensor misalignment or a beam obstruction in Bryn Athyn. Receiver LED off, transmitter LED solid indicates no power to the receiver, which points to a wiring fault or receiver failure in Bryn Athyn, PA. Both LEDs off indicates no power to either sensor, which points to the sensor wiring connection at the opener control board in Bryn Athyn.

Misalignment vs Component Failure — How to Tell the Difference in Bryn Athyn

A blinking receiver LED indicates the receiver isn't detecting the full beam from the transmitter in Bryn Athyn, PA. This can mean the sensor bracket has rotated out of the correct alignment or the sensor component itself has failed in Bryn Athyn. To distinguish between the two, EZ Open gently adjusts the receiver bracket through its full range of angles while watching the LED in Bryn Athyn, PA. If the LED becomes solid at any angle, the sensor is functional but misaligned in Bryn Athyn. If the LED stays blinking through the full range of bracket adjustment, the sensor itself has failed and requires replacement in Bryn Athyn, PA.

Why Sunlight Can Produce the Exact Same Symptom as a Failed Sensor in Bryn Athyn, PA

Direct sunlight contains infrared radiation at intensities that can overwhelm the receiver's ability to distinguish the transmitter's signal from the background in Bryn Athyn. When direct sunlight hits the receiver lens at a specific angle, the receiver can't confirm the transmitter's beam against the solar infrared background in Bryn Athyn, PA. The opener reverses the door exactly as it would for a misaligned sensor or a physical obstruction in Bryn Athyn. A door that won't close only at specific times of day when the sun is at a particular angle is almost certainly experiencing solar interference in Bryn Athyn, PA.

Down-Travel Limit Set Too High in Bryn Athyn

The down-travel limit setting tells the opener when to stop the closing cycle in Bryn Athyn, PA. A limit set too high stops the opener before the door reaches the floor in Bryn Athyn. The door stops short of the floor without reversing in Bryn Athyn, PA. This is often confused with a sensor fault but produces a distinctly different symptom, the door stops rather than reverses in Bryn Athyn. A limit calibration adjustment resolves this cause immediately in Bryn Athyn, PA.

Spring Imbalance Triggering Force Limit in Bryn Athyn, PA

A spring that has lost significant tension produces a heavier door in Bryn Athyn. The heavier door requires more closing force from the opener in Bryn Athyn, PA. If the required closing force exceeds the opener's force limit setting, the opener stops before the door reaches the floor in Bryn Athyn. This produces a door that stops short without reversing in Bryn Athyn, PA. Spring assessment and replacement where indicated alongside force limit recalibration addresses this cause in Bryn Athyn.

Damaged Wiring Between Sensor and Opener in Bryn Athyn, PA

The low-voltage wiring connecting each sensor to the opener control board runs from the sensor bracket up the door frame and along the ceiling to the opener in Bryn Athyn. Damage at any point along this run, from a staple that pierced the wire, a rodent that chewed through it, or physical disturbance that cut or kinked it, can produce sensor symptoms that appear identical to sensor failure or misalignment in Bryn Athyn, PA. EZ Open inspects the complete wiring run where sensor LED behavior doesn't clearly indicate misalignment or component failure in Bryn Athyn.

Yes, surprisingly often in Bryn Athyn. A spider web spun across the sensor lenses, or even a single insect resting directly on a sensor, can be enough to interrupt or scatter the infrared beam in Bryn Athyn, PA. This produces the same blinking LED and reversal symptom as a misaligned or failed sensor in Bryn Athyn. Wiping both sensor lenses with a soft dry cloth is a simple first check before assuming a more involved repair is needed in Bryn Athyn, PA.

Use a soft, dry, lint-free cloth to gently wipe the lens of each sensor in Bryn Athyn. Avoid using water, glass cleaner, or any abrasive material, since the lens coating can be sensitive in Bryn Athyn, PA. Check that both sensors are free of cobwebs, dust buildup, and any obstruction directly in the beam path between them in Bryn Athyn. If cleaning doesn't resolve a blinking LED, the issue is likely alignment or a component fault rather than dirt in Bryn Athyn, PA.
